Etymology
The name ‘Leptis’ originates from the ancient Berber name for the city of Leptis Magna, a major Roman city in present-day Libya.
Linguistic family: Afroasiatic > Berber
Cultural context
Leptis Magna was one of the most important cities of Roman Africa and holds significant historical importance for Libya. The name reflects a connection to this ancient heritage.
Symbolism
The name symbolises a link to Libya’s rich ancient history and the legacy of Leptis Magna as a centre of culture and trade.
